1. Haier HCE519F

If you don't mind paying a little extra for more space, this tough and built-to-last chest freezer is ideal. With a 252-litre capacity it can accommodate more than 10 bags of grocery and is ideal for large households. It's designed to be used in garages and outbuildings that are not heated as well, and it also makes use of low frost technology for easy maintenance. This means it only requires defrosting every couple of years.

The lid is counterbalanced, so it is easy to sift your contents and not worry about the lid striking you in the head. This is especially useful when you are retrieving forgotten frozen fish fingers. A wire basket is able to be clipped onto the rim to store smaller items. It also has an internal light that assists you in sorting through your contents.

The freezer's energy consumption is rated as A in the latest energy efficiency scale that's why it's a great option if you're looking to save money on electricity. It will keep your food secure for up to 24 hours in case of a power interruption, which gives peace of mind.

4. Bush BECF99L

This Bush chest freezer will provide you with extra storage space at an affordable price. It's a great size to put in the corner of your home and can be utilized in areas that aren't heated, such as garages or outbuildings. It comes with a lid that's counterbalanced so it doesn't shut on your head when you're removing food items. It's also almost silent, meaning that you won't be disturbed by it while at home. The only drawback is that it doesn't have a display with a digital screen or temperature warnings, and there's only one storage basket inside the freezer.

With a huge capacity of 139 Liters the chest freezer is large enough to hold 10 bags of shopping. It's also compact and quiet so it won't take up too much space in your kitchen. chest freezer suitable for garage comes with an A+ energy rating, which means it's low-cost to run and good for the environment as well.
